Memory Circuit Design Engineer
This engineer will work within Intel’s Advanced Design organization to create memory technology collateral and IP that supports high-performance, high-density, and low-power products. Responsibilities span memory pathfinding, SRAM or other memory circuit design, bit-cell and peripheral layout, automation, test-chip development, and optimization of power, performance, and area. The role also includes pre-silicon verification and post-silicon validation to monitor yield and device parameters and resolve design issues. The engineer will collaborate with process-technology experts, EDA suppliers, and product teams across Intel Foundry. It is well suited to an experienced memory or custom-circuit designer with advanced engineering education and hands-on knowledge of simulation, layout, verification, and CMOS design flows.
